They got out of Oklahoma alive. With a baby on the way, Lee Hammond and Vivian Baxter have settled down to uncomplicated domesticity—until Lee finds bugs in the smoke detectors. The electronic kind.

It seems that there are a few details about her past that Vivian has neglected to share with Lee, and the men with the big guns are back. They want what Vivian took from them: the thirty million dollar Devil’s Diamond.

From the bright lights of Vegas to the dazzling sights of Hollywood, the chase is on in Layce Gardner’s sequel to the instant sensation Tats.
